The family of Halyna Hutchins, the cinematographer shot and killed on the set of "Rust" on Oct. 21, announced the filing of a wrongful death lawsuit at a press conference Tuesday.

The lawsuit, which was filed on behalf of Halyna's husband, Matthew Hutchins, and their son, Andros, in New Mexico, names Alec Baldwin and others who "are responsible for the safety on the set" and "reckless behavior and cost-cutting" that led to the death of Hutchins, according to Hutchins' lawyer.

Armorer Hannah Gutierrez Reed, assistant director David Halls, production companies and producers are also named in the lawsuit.

Halyna Hutchins is survived by her husband, Matthew Hutchins, and son Andros Hutchins. (Panish Shea Boyle Ravipudi LLP) Representatives for Baldwin, Gutierrez Reed and Halls did not immediately respond to Fox News Digital's request for comment.
